Output b645f264196e23bbc47613b5410d77ee391d7cb7b5ca0d68551898031379ca01:5

value
568000
script pubkey
OP_0 OP_PUSHBYTES_20 c28c066aac6e48e23aa5e92fb2e43a1dcf85f891
address
bc1qc2xqv64vdeywyw49ayhm9ep6rh8ct7y384ud6p
transaction
b645f264196e23bbc47613b5410d77ee391d7cb7b5ca0d68551898031379ca01
confirmations
134636
spent
true